    Cargo Operator

    Job description

    Listing Info

    We are currently representing an International oil corporation who operate numerous of deepwater and shallow-offshore assets, at various development stages.

    They Are Now Seeking To Identify An Cargo Operator Who Can Join Their Team On Matters Including

    1) Process

    • Start up, Operate, Monitor and Shut Down Process and Utility Systems.
    • Monitor, maintain and optimize process parameters (Level, flow, temperature, pressure etc) within operating

    requirements.
    • Trouble shoot to maximize sales quality and delivery volume to identify problems.
    • Monitor and operate electrical/hydraulic control panels, safety and emergency shutdown devices, Fire and Gas

    Systems.
    • Ensure accurate production reporting is submitted daily or as required by company and client.
    • Witness third party calibrations when appropriate to provide verification of meter factors and volumes.

    2) Marine/Safety
    • Implementing and enforcing NMA policies and procedures in particular Isolation Standards, and PTW.
    • Carry out all operations in safe and environmentally sound manner.
    • Report all discharges, leaks, spills, injuries, and incidents, immediately.
    • Ensure personnel understand and comply with current environmental regulations.
    • Carry out Emergency Response role

    3) Maintenance
    • Assist maintenance operations by applying/removing isolations as required.
    • Supervise operation of PTW system.
    • Advise maintenance personnel on hazards of plant and equipment.
    • Maintain clear and precise communications during maintenance operations.

    4) Manage & Supervise Effectively
    • Coordinate activities and resources across teams or shift.
    • Contribute to training and assessment of personnel.
    • Control activities and development of subordinate personnel.
    • Record and report on personnel development/appraisals and competence assessments as required.
    • Efficiency improvement and pursue company goals.
    • Create and maintain effective working relationships

    Units Of Competence
    • Prepare process and utility systems for remote operation
    • Remotely operate and monitor process and utility systems
    • Prepare process and utility systems for shutdown
    • Isolate and reinstate process and utility systems for maintenance and repair
    • Contribute to control of critical situations and respond to emergencies
    • Monitor and maintain pollution control measures
    • Manage and Supervise Effectively
    • Carry out Emergency Response role

    Pre-hire Qualifications And Experience
    • 8 years minimum in Hydrocarbon processing operations with 2 years as CCRO and appropriate mix of
    • operational and supervisory experience.
    • Offshore Personal Survival, Management of Major Emergencies, Medical certificates.
    • Good level of troubleshooting and operations knowledge including interpretation of P&IDs and C&E charts.
    • Extensive knowledge of offshore FPSO operations, including Production, Maintenance, Engineering and Safety.
    • Extensive knowledge of DCS and F&G systems operation
    Personal Skills

    Personal: Conscientious, flexible, versatile and determined. Capable of assertive and positive communication and performance.
    Leadership: Assertive leadership skills. Good levels of written and spoken communication in English language. Clear understanding of behavioral and logistical personnel issues.
    Technical: High standard of technical and professional knowledge as defined by competences. Good knowledge of DCS/SCADA systems. Some knowledge of cargo handling and marine utility systems where appropriate for position.
    IT: Practical familiarity with standard 'Office' software package. Operation and use of Internet and electronic mail system.
    Minimum Unlimited OOW - Officer of Watch Marine License

    · Marine operations - Oil and Gas Cargo Handling
    · Have working knowledge of applicable marine international regulations, including but not limited to MARPOL, SOLAS, and ISGOTT. Be sufficiently familiar with these regulations to play an effective part in safeguarding the interests of Company and its employees
     
    Responsibilities

    · Maintain FCC cargo operation watch as required by Cargo Supervisor and FSO Manager's standing orders.
    · As an FCC watchstander, must be completely familiar with the FSO's FCC monitoring and safety systems, the cargo and ballast system, including the refrigeration and liquefaction plant, and have the knowledge to lay out cargo for loading and export operation
    · He should be able to handle routine traffic situations, such as when vessel traffic too close to the FSO threatens mooring arrangements, with occasional reference to their seniors and would show good judgment in calling the FSO manager before an unusual situation becomes critical.
    · The Cargo Operator would know when a change of FCC watchkeeping mode was required, and put steps in motion to respond to the need. The FSO Manager should advise the officer of the FSO manager's own specific directives when required by STCW.
